Advertisement

四种方法修改js中的onclick事件(推荐)

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文介绍了如何在JavaScript中使用四种不同的方式来更新或替换已有的onclick事件处理程序。适合需要灵活控制网页元素交互行为的开发者阅读参考。 以下是四种为按钮添加点击事件的方法: 第一种:`button.onclick = Function(alert(hello););` 第二种:`button.onclick = function(){ alert(hello); };` 第三种:定义一个名为 `myAlert` 的函数,然后将其赋值给 `button.onclick`: ```javascript function myAlert() { alert(hello); } button.onclick = myAlert; ``` 第四种方法更为动态,并且可以添加多个事件处理程序(按照添加的顺序执行)。例如: 如果浏览器支持 `addEventListener` 方法,则使用该方法来为按钮添加点击事件。这样做的好处是能够向同一个元素上绑定多个独立的函数,而且这些函数会根据它们被绑定到元素上的先后顺序依次触发。 ```javascript if(window.addEventListener){ // 在这里可以继续添加更多代码以实现动态事件处理功能。 } ``` 这种方法非常适合需要在按钮点击时执行一系列操作的情况。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• jsonclick
    优质
    本文介绍了如何在JavaScript中使用四种不同的方式来更新或替换已有的onclick事件处理程序。适合需要灵活控制网页元素交互行为的开发者阅读参考。 以下是四种为按钮添加点击事件的方法: 第一种:`button.onclick = Function(alert(hello););` 第二种:`button.onclick = function(){ alert(hello); };` 第三种:定义一个名为 `myAlert` 的函数,然后将其赋值给 `button.onclick`: ```javascript function myAlert() { alert(hello); } button.onclick = myAlert; ``` 第四种方法更为动态,并且可以添加多个事件处理程序(按照添加的顺序执行)。例如: 如果浏览器支持 `addEventListener` 方法,则使用该方法来为按钮添加点击事件。这样做的好处是能够向同一个元素上绑定多个独立的函数,而且这些函数会根据它们被绑定到元素上的先后顺序依次触发。 ```javascript if(window.addEventListener){ // 在这里可以继续添加更多代码以实现动态事件处理功能。 } ``` 这种方法非常适合需要在按钮点击时执行一系列操作的情况。
  • Android开发onClick
    优质
    本文介绍了在Android开发中实现按钮点击监听的四种方法,帮助开发者选择最适合项目的实现方式。 在Android应用开发过程中,onClick事件是用户与界面交互的重要组成部分。当用户点击按钮或其他可点击视图时,它能够触发相应的处理代码。本教程将深入探讨四种常见的实现方式,帮助初学者更好地理解和运用这些技术。 1. **XML布局文件中声明onClick**:可以在布局的XML文件里通过添加`android:onClick`属性来指定一个方法用于处理按钮等元素点击事件。例如: ```xml
  • 解决IE8JavaScript onclick不兼容
    优质
    简介:本文提供了解决Internet Explorer 8浏览器中JavaScript onclick事件不兼容问题的有效方法,帮助开发者优化代码以适应多种浏览器环境。 本段落主要介绍了IE8的JavaScript点击事件(onclick)不兼容问题的解决方法,可供参考使用。
  • JS自调用匿名函数()
    优质
    本文介绍了JavaScript中实现自调用匿名函数的三种不同方式,帮助开发者更好地理解并灵活运用这一特性。适合需要提高代码模块化和封装性的读者阅读。 以下是三种 JavaScript 自调用匿名函数的写法: 第一种:`(function(){ console.log(hello world)})()` 第二种:`(function(){ console.log(hello world)}())` 第三种:`!function(){ console.log(hello world)}()` 以上就是小编分享给大家的内容,希望能对大家有所帮助。
  • JSPonclick页面
    优质
    本文将详细介绍在Java Server Pages (JSP)中如何使用onclick事件处理页面上的用户交互,包括其基本语法和应用场景。 JSP的onclick页面事件包括打开保存、跳转和关闭等功能。
  • JavaScript onclick详解
    优质
    本篇文章详细介绍了JavaScript中的onclick事件及其使用方法,帮助读者掌握如何通过该事件实现网页元素的交互功能。 本段落详细介绍了JavaScript的onclick事件使用方法,并通过示例代码进行了讲解。内容对学习或工作中遇到的相关问题具有参考价值,有需要的朋友可以参考这篇文章。
  • 在Java添加按钮及响应
    优质
    本教程详细介绍如何在Java应用程序中创建按钮并为其添加响应事件的功能,适合初学者快速掌握相关技能。 下面为大家介绍如何在Java程序中添加按钮并为其绑定响应事件的方法(推荐)。我觉得这种方法非常实用,现在分享给大家参考。一起看看吧。
  • layui table单元格值
    优质
    本文介绍了在使用layui框架时,如何监听并实现table组件中单元格值的修改功能,提供了详细的方法和代码示例。 在事件处理中的 `this` 相当于用 `document.getElementById(id)` 替代的方法就是将原本的 `document.getElementById(id).innerHTML = 填充代码;` 替换成使用 jQuery 的 `$().html(填充代码);` 例如,假设有一个 HTML 文档: ```html layui ``` 在使用 jQuery 的情况下,可以将上述的 DOM 操作简化为: ```javascript $(#id).html(填充代码); ``` 这样的写法更加简洁和易于维护。
  • 关于Tomcat部署Web应用总结(
    优质
    本文全面总结了在Apache Tomcat服务器上部署Web应用程序的四种常用方法,并推荐最佳实践,帮助开发者轻松掌握部署技巧。 本段落主要介绍了在Tomcat服务器上部署Web应用的四种方法:自动部署、通过控制台进行部署、增加自定义的Web应用程序文件以及手动编辑%Tomcat_Home%/conf/server.xml文件来完成部署操作,有兴趣的朋友可以参考了解这些内容。
  • JS动态添加DIV onclick示例讲解
    优质
    本教程详细介绍了如何在JavaScript中为动态创建的DIV元素添加onclick事件处理程序,提供实用代码和应用场景解析。 下面为大家带来一篇关于在JavaScript动态添加的DIV中使用onclick事件的简单实例。我觉得这篇文章挺不错的,现在分享给大家作为参考。一起看看吧。